WebThe first thing that might come to mind is simply running out of battery or feeling ‘range anxiety’. But it turns out an empty battery is not the biggest issue. According to LV Britannia Rescue, only 11% of EV callouts deal with running out of battery. Instead, it’s the 36% of callouts for wheels and tyre problems that are becoming a ...
